More about Devan

Devan has been working in clinics since 2009 as a touch therapist offering massage and craniosacral. In 2021, after seeking help for the distress she was experiencing around the Kamloops residential school discovery, she had an experience that shifted her perspective on how and why tissues become difficult to treat. Unbeknownst to her at the time it would forever change the way she approached her clients’ clinical treatments and, surprisingly, her own ancestral and childhood trauma healing.

Having come out the other side from a dark past and successfully transforming her wounds with the help of a skilled team she decided she needed to learn this craft. She dove head first into becoming trauma informed and began her in depth understanding of the adverse childhood experiences, poly vagal theory, window of tolerance, attachment theory, ancestral trauma and the cutting edge neuroscience that’s come out on the body/mind connection.

She took this new found knowledge and blended it with her coaching, massage, craniosacral, and somato-emotional release training to create Introspective Embodiment Coaching.
